  7. Pennsylvania Route 191 ( PA 191) is a 111.54 mi (179.51 km)-long state highway in the U.S. state of Pennsylvania. The route, a major non-freeway corridor connecting the Lehigh Valley to the Pocono Mountains in eastern Pennsylvania, is designated from U.S. Route 22 (US 22) in Brodhead near Bethlehem to the New York state line over the Delaware ...

  9. U.S. Route 209 (US 209) is a 211.74-mile (340.76 km) long U.S. Highway in the states of Pennsylvania and New York. Although the route is a spur of US 9, US 209 never intersects US 9, coming within five miles of the route and making the short connection via New York State Route 199 (NY 199).   10. Jan 16, 2021 · U.S. 209 originates in Millersburg along the Susquehanna River in east central Pennsylvania. The highway runs 150 miles northeast along a mostly rural course to the Delaware River at Matamoras. U.S. 209 travels across northern Dauphin County from PA 147 to Elizabethville and Lykens.
